How Utah Businesses Can Generate More Customer Referrals

Generating customer referrals is a powerful way to grow your Utah business. Referrals often bring higher-quality leads and improve customer loyalty. Here are practical steps to increase customer referrals while maintaining compliance and operational efficiency.

Develop a Referral Program

  • Create clear incentives: Offer discounts, gift cards, or service upgrades to customers who refer others. Ensure the incentives comply with Utah's business and tax regulations.
  • Set simple rules: Make the referral process easy to understand and participate in. Clearly communicate eligibility and reward conditions to avoid confusion.
  • Track referrals accurately: Use automation tools or customer relationship management (CRM) software to record and manage referrals efficiently.

Leverage Customer Experience

  • Deliver exceptional service: Satisfied customers are more likely to refer others. Focus on quality, responsiveness, and personalized interactions.
  • Request referrals at key moments: Ask for referrals after successful transactions or positive feedback to increase success rates.

Utilize Digital Marketing and Social Media

  • Encourage online reviews and shares: Positive online reviews on platforms like Google and Yelp can drive referrals.
  • Implement shareable content: Create engaging content that customers want to share with their networks, increasing organic referrals.
  • Use email campaigns: Send targeted emails encouraging referrals and providing easy ways to share your business.

Maintain Compliance and Recordkeeping

  • Review Utah business regulations: Ensure referral incentives do not violate any state laws or licensing requirements.
  • Manage tax implications: Track referral rewards as taxable income or business expenses according to Utah tax rules.
  • Document referral transactions: Keep clear records for bookkeeping and potential audits.

Train Your Team

  • Educate employees: Ensure staff understand the referral program and can explain it to customers effectively.
  • Encourage employee referrals: Motivate your team to refer potential clients or partners, expanding your network.

By combining a structured referral program with excellent customer service, digital marketing, and proper compliance, Utah businesses can sustainably increase customer referrals and drive growth.
